740YP is a cell-permeable phosphopeptide that acts as a potent and specific activator of phosphoinositide 3-kinase (PI3K). It consists of a sequence derived from the platelet-derived growth factor receptor (PDGFR) phosphorylated at Tyr-740, coupled to a cell-penetrating peptide sequence (Antennapedia). 740YP works by binding to the SH2 domains of the p85 regulatory subunit of PI3K, thereby mimicking the natural activation process and stimulating the PI3K/Akt/mTOR signaling pathway. In clinical research led by the National Foundation for Fertility Research, 740YP is utilized in an 'In Vitro Activation' (IVA) protocol for women with primary ovarian insufficiency (POI) and infertility. In this procedure, ovarian tissue is treated ex vivo with 740YP and the PTEN inhibitor bpV(hopic) to awaken dormant primordial follicles before being autografted back into the patient to restore reproductive function.
